1. You Stop Being Affectionate
You might’ve been all over each other at the beginning of the relationship, but a lot of time has passed and you don’t feel like kissing your partner as much or you might even go to bed at different times.
Unfortunately, all these things can lead to losing affection for each other and feeling disconnected. Make sure to talk to your partner about all these things and find your love language.
2. You Have An All-Or-Nothing Approach When You’re Fighting
When people have a big fight with their partners, the first thing that might come to mind is to start yelling at them and saying a lot of things they regret afterward. On the exact opposite side, there are people who prefer to stay quiet and deal with their emotions when the conflict is over.
None of these two examples is the way to go. One of the best things you could possibly do is to have an honest conversation in which you listen to one another and understand what you’re both saying.
In conformity with many experts, the key ingredient for a happy relationship is to focus on the things you love about your partner, rather than picking fights all the time.
This doesn’t mean that you should neglect all the things you don’t like, but you can make an effort and come up with a mutual solution on how to become stronger and more content as a couple.
3. You Don’t Go Out On Dates Anymore
When couples stop having fun together, they begin to stop making each other a priority. In order to avoid this annoying situation, make sure to schedule a date night every single week and treat it as an appointment with your doctor or with your boss. This way you won’t neglect it and you’ll have plenty of time to enjoy the time spent with one another.
4. You Let Yourself Go
When people get involved in a serious relationship, they tend to get comfortable and neglect themselves. This means that they no longer care about keeping up with a healthy lifestyle, eating clean, and working out consistently, because they don’t want to attract anybody.
However, these things can be damaging in the long run. That is because they might trigger a lack of confidence, laziness, and poor choices. Self-care is always important, regardless of if you’re in a relationship or not.
Schedule time for yourself, relax, enjoy your own company, work on yourself, and be confident! We can guarantee to you that your partner will appreciate all the time you invest in yourself!

5. You Don’t Support Your Partner
Being in a relationship means more than living together, kissing, and eating at the same table. It’s also about boundaries, support, respect, and so many other things.
There are many couples who go into therapy and one of the partners complains that their significant other’s family hurt them. In cases like this, you should set boundaries and ask everyone to be respectful and understanding.
Have your partner’s back, listen to them, and support them when they need it!
6. Your Relationship Isn’t Your Priority
We’re not saying that you should neglect your work, kids, grandchildren, or any other important aspects of your life just to stay connected to your partner, but in order to keep growing and evolving, you need to make your relationship a priority.
You can simply turn off your phone when you’re both together and talk about your day, go out together, have fun, make eye contact, and celebrate the time you get to spend together!
7. You Don’t Consult Your Significant Other
A serious relationship means being part of a team, right? So it’s completely understandable that you should consult with your partner every time there’s a serious decision involved, such as moving somewhere else, buying a car, quitting your job, purchasing a home, and so many other things.
Asking your partner about their opinion and talking to them about all these things will show them that you care about their thoughts and opinions and they will understand that they are important in your life.
